How Robot Vacuum and Mop Cleaners Work: A Symphony of Sensors and Smart Technology
Robot vacuum and mop cleaners are advanced devices that make use of a mix of sensing units, algorithms, and mechanical elements to browse and clean floorings autonomously. While the particular technology might vary in between designs and brand names, the fundamental principles remain consistent.
At their core, these robotics rely on a suite of sensing units to perceive their environment. These sensors can include:
- Bump sensors: Detect crashes with obstacles, prompting the robot to change instructions.
- Cliff sensing units: Prevent the robot from dropping stairs or ledges by finding drops in elevation.
- Wall sensors: Allow the robot to follow walls and edges for extensive cleaning.
- Optical and infrared sensing units: Used for navigation, mapping, and object detection, helping the robot develop effective cleaning courses and avoid barriers.
- Gyroscope and accelerometer: Help the robot track its movement and orientation, adding to accurate navigation and location protection.
These sensing units feed information to an onboard computer system that processes details and directs the robot's movement. Numerous contemporary robot vacuum and mops make use of innovative navigation technologies such as:
- Random Bounce Navigation: Older and simpler models often use this approach, moving arbitrarily till they come across a barrier, then changing instructions. While less effective, they can still cover a location with time.
- Systematic Navigation: More advanced robots utilize organized cleaning patterns, such as zig-zag or spiral movements, to ensure more complete and effective coverage.
- Smart Mapping: High-end models include advanced mapping abilities, frequently using LiDAR (Light Detection and Ranging) or vSLAM (visual Simultaneous Localization and Mapping). vacume robot to produce in-depth maps of the home, enabling them to tidy particular rooms, set virtual borders, and find out the layout for enhanced cleaning paths.
The cleaning process itself involves two primary functions: vacuuming and mopping.
- Vacuuming: Robot vacuums utilize brushes to loosen debris from the floor and a powerful suction motor to draw dirt, dust, pet hair, and other particles into a dustbin. Various brush types and suction levels accommodate different floor types, from hard floors to carpets.
- Mopping: Robot mops typically include a water tank and a mopping pad. The robot gives water onto the pad, which then cleans the floor. Some designs provide vibrating or oscillating mopping pads for more effective stain removal. Various mopping modes and water flow settings are typically available to suit different floor types and cleaning needs.

Browsing the Options: Types of Robot Vacuum and Mops
The robot vacuum and mop market is varied, providing different designs with different functionalities. Here's a basic categorization to help understand the options:
- Robot Vacuums Only: These are dedicated vacuuming robotics that focus solely on dry cleaning. They are typically more economical and often provide robust vacuuming performance.
- 2-in-1 Robot Vacuum and Mops: These flexible gadgets integrate both vacuuming and mopping performances. They provide benefit and space-saving benefits, though mopping efficiency might be less extensive than dedicated robot mops in some designs.
- Dedicated Robot Mops: These robots are particularly designed for mopping tough floors. They often feature more advanced mopping systems, such as vibrating pads and accurate water giving control, for efficient wet cleaning.
- Self-Emptying Robot Vacuums: These premium models include a charging base that likewise operates as a dustbin. When the robot's dustbin is complete, it instantly clears into the larger base dustbin, considerably reducing manual clearing frequency.
- Smart Robot Vacuums and Mops: These sophisticated robotics are geared up with smart features like Wi-Fi connectivity, smart device app control, voice assistant integration (e.g., Alexa, Google Assistant), space mapping, and virtual no-go zones.
Selecting the Right Robotic Cleaning Companion: Factors to Consider
Selecting the perfect robot vacuum and mop cleaner requires careful factor to consider of specific needs and home attributes. Here are key elements to examine:
- Home Size and Layout: Larger homes or those with complex layouts may benefit from robots with smart mapping and long battery life for efficient protection. Smaller sized apartments can be effectively served by easier designs.
- Floor Types: Consider the main floor enters your home. For homes with mostly hard floorings, a 2-in-1 or devoted robot mop is perfect. For carpeted homes, prioritize models with strong suction and efficient carpet brushes. For homes with a mix of floor types, look for robotics that can deal with shifts and offer adjustable settings for various surface areas.
- Pet Ownership: If you have animals, prioritize robotics with powerful suction, tangle-free brushes, and larger dustbins to effectively handle pet hair and dander.
- Budget plan: Robot vacuum and mop prices differ substantially. Define your spending plan and explore models within your price variety. Keep in mind that higher-priced models typically offer advanced features and better performance but standard designs can still be extremely efficient.
- Smart Features: Determine which smart functions are important for you. Wi-Fi connectivity, app control, room mapping, and voice assistant integration can considerably enhance benefit and control.
- Battery Life and Coverage Area: Ensure the robot's battery life and coverage area suffice for your home size. Think about designs with automatic recharging and resume cleaning functions for larger areas.
- Maintenance Requirements: Consider the ease of upkeep. Search for models with quickly available dustbins, washable filters, and exchangeable brushes. Self-emptying models decrease the frequency of dustbin emptying.
Preserving Your Robot Vacuum and Mop: Ensuring Longevity and Performance
To ensure your robot vacuum and mop runs effectively and lasts for many years, routine maintenance is vital. Secret upkeep tasks include:
- Emptying the Dustbin: Empty the dustbin routinely, ideally after each cleaning cycle, to maintain optimum suction performance.
- Cleaning or Replacing Filters: Clean or change filters according to the manufacturer's suggestions. Clogged filters lower suction and cleaning effectiveness.
- Cleaning Brushes: Remove hair and debris tangled in the brushes routinely. Some models feature tools particularly created for brush cleaning.
- Cleaning Mop Pads: Wash or replace mop pads after each mopping cycle to keep health and cleaning efficiency.
- Cleaning Sensors: Periodically clean the robot's sensors with a soft, dry fabric to ensure precise navigation and obstacle detection.
- Inspecting for Obstructions: Regularly examine the robot's path for potential obstructions like cables or small items that could get tangled.
By following these basic maintenance actions, you can guarantee your robot vacuum and mop continues to supply dependable and efficient cleaning for years to come.

Often Asked Questions (FAQs) about Robot Vacuum and Mop Cleaners
Q1: Are robot vacuum and mops as effective as conventional vacuum and mops?
- Robot vacuums and mops are generally reliable for daily cleaning and maintenance. They might not be as effective as high-end traditional vacuum cleaners for deep cleaning really thick carpets or getting rid of greatly ingrained discolorations. However, for regular upkeep and preserving a tidy home, they are extremely efficient and practical.
Q2: Can robot vacuum and mops clean up all kinds of floorings?
- A lot of robot vacuums and mops are designed to clean difficult floors like wood, tile, laminate, and linoleum. Numerous designs can likewise deal with low-pile carpets and rugs. However, incredibly plush or high-pile carpets may pose challenges for some robotics. Always inspect the producer's requirements relating to floor types.
Q3: Do robot vacuum and mops need Wi-Fi to run?
- Basic robot vacuum and mops without smart functions can operate without Wi-Fi. However, models with Wi-Fi connection offer boosted functions like smartphone app control, scheduling, space mapping, and voice assistant combination. Wi-Fi is essential to use these smart performances.
Q4: How long do robot vacuum and mops usually last?
- The life expectancy of a robot vacuum and mop depends on usage, upkeep, and the quality of the gadget. With appropriate maintenance, a good quality robot vacuum and mop can last for numerous years, typically ranging from 3 to 5 years or perhaps longer.
Q5: Are robot vacuum and mops noisy?
- Robot vacuums and mops usually produce less sound than standard vacuum. Sound levels differ in between models, but numerous are created to operate silently enough not to be disruptive during normal home activities.
Q6: Can robot vacuum and mops tidy pet hair successfully?
- Yes, numerous robot vacuums are particularly created for pet hair removal. Search for models with functions like strong suction, tangle-free brushes, and larger dustbins, which are especially effective at picking up pet hair and dander.
Q7: What takes place if a robot vacuum and mop gets stuck?
- Modern robot vacuum and mops are equipped with sensors and challenge avoidance technology to lessen getting stuck. Nevertheless, they may periodically get stuck on loose cable televisions, small items, or in tight corners. Numerous models will immediately stop and send out an alert if they get stuck.
Q8: Do I need to prepare my house before utilizing a robot vacuum and mop?
- It's recommended to declutter floorings by getting rid of small items, cable televisions, and loose items that might block the robot or get tangled in the brushes. Stashing chair legs and raising curtains can also improve cleaning efficiency.
Q9: Can robot vacuum and mops climb over thresholds?
- A lot of robot vacuum and mops can climb up over low thresholds, generally around 0.5 to 0.75 inches. Nevertheless, greater limits may avoid them from moving between rooms. Check the maker's specs for limit climbing up capability.
